Casement windows have gained popularity among homeowners due to their style, performance, and energy efficiency. A casement window is hinged on one side, permitting it to swing open like a door, providing outstanding ventilation and unblocked views. Typical Types of Casement Windows
Understanding the different types of Casement Window Installation Company windows offered can help homeowners in their selection process. Below is a list of common types:

Standard Casement Window Installation Cost Windows: Hinged on one side, opening external with a crank manage.

Awning Windows: Similar to casement windows but hinged at the top, these windows open outward from the bottom, permitting ventilation even throughout rain.

Combination Windows: A mix of different window styles, where casement windows are combined with fixed or sliding windows for aesthetic appeal.

Corner Casement Windows: Installed at the corner of a home, offering scenic views and special architectural styles.
FAQs1. The length of time does the installation of casement windows usually take?
The installation period can differ based upon the number of windows being replaced, but a lot of tasks can be completed within a day or 2.
2. Are casement windows energy-efficient?
Yes, casement windows are typically considered energy-efficient due to their tight seal when closed, minimizing air leakage.
3. What is the average cost of casement windows?
Cost varies based upon materials, style, and local labor markets. On average, house owners can anticipate to pay between 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window.
4. Can I install casement windows myself?
While DIY installation is possible, it is not advised unless you are experienced in window installation. Professional specialists make sure appropriate sealing and compliance with codes.
5. What upkeep do casement windows require?
Regular upkeep consists of checking seals, cleaning the frames and glass, and guaranteeing the opening system functions smoothly.
